The dividend yield ratio (also referred to as the “dividend price ratio”) is a common way of calculating the relative value of a dividend payout for a dividend paying stock based off of the ...Dividend yield = Annual dividend per share/Current stock price. As an example, if a stock costs $100 and pays an annual dividend of $7 the dividend yield will be $7/$100, or 7%. Like the dividend payout ratio, dividend yield is a metric investors can use when comparing stocks to understand the health of a company.

Determine the DPS of the stock. Find the most recent DPS value of the stock you own. Again, the formula is DPS = (D - SD)/S where D = the amount of money paid in regular dividends, SD = the amount paid in special, one-time dividends, and S = the total number of shares of company stock owned by all investors.
